Elmwood Cemetery
Memphis, Tn.

George Franklin Glover
George Glover was born to Nathan O' Neal Glover and Emma Jane
Gray December 24, 1879 in Taylor County, Ga. He died in Memphis, Tn. March 25, 1924 from
complications of measles. He was married to Elizabeth (Lizzie) Merritt. Two
children survived him Warine Glover and Hugh Samuel Glover. After the death of
George, Lizzie took the children and moved back to Geneva County, Al.

Walter Cooper
Born to Rodell Cooper and Norma Jefferies July 24, 1940 in Annie's Woods, Illinois.
He died in Memphis, Tn. August 5, 1987 in Memphis,Tn. from complications of heart
surgery.
